Gold medal won by Frank Beaurepaire for first place in the 440 Yards swim on 5th February, 1910. Medal features A.S.S.A. monogram above a shield similar to that of New South Wales. It is supported by a fish at each side. Surrounding text in legend reads "AUSTRALASIAN AMATEUR SWIMMING CHAMPIONSHIPS". Reverse inscription framed by wreath reads, "440 YARDS / Championship / of Australia / Won by / F. BEAUREPAIRE / at Melbourne / 5.2.1910 / Time 5 min 36 2/5 secs".
